		<description>In 2009 our Oregon family celebrated my mother-in-law, Marta Walsh&#039;s 100th birthday with a hot air balloon ride and a family reunion in CA.  On the way back home, we stopped at the Chateau for a final celebratory fling for and by the birthday gal.  During check-in, she heard the place was haunted. Later, during her nap time, with her diminished hearing, she thought either the ghosts or mice were in her closet...it was actually the noise made by the Ringtail Cats frolicking between the floors.  The &#039;haunted&#039; rumor, however, persisted and later before dinner she was talking to the front desk when a couple came in to check if there were any rooms still available.  They overheard the talk of ghosts and decided to leave immediately...we all had a good laugh.  Our whole family truly enjoyed a memorable visit to both the caves and the wonderful Chateau.  Btw...three of us younger ones searched, with cameras ready, for the ghost on the designated floor...no luck.  Marta is no longer with us but we will certainly be back!
